One common mistake is using apostrophes with regular plural nouns that are not possessive. For instance, writing "apples'" when you just mean "apples" (more than one apple). Remember, the apostrophe indicates ownership, so only use it when you want to show that something belongs to someone or something. It's also worth noting that some style guides recommend avoiding possessives in certain situations, especially when dealing with inanimate objects. Instead of saying "the table's leg," for example, it's often better to say "the leg of the table." Keep this in mind as you hone your writing skills.
